Toll‐like receptor‐4 is expressed in meningiomas and mediates the antiproliferative action of paclitaxel

Abstract: Meningiomas are the second most common type of brain and CNS tumors by histology. Surgery and radiotherapy are main treatment options, but meningiomas may be impossible to adequately resect or may regrow after surgery. In spite of many experimental attempts, there is no generally accepted chemotherapeutic approach. We have studied in a series of meningiomas the expression of the Toll-like receptor 4 (TLR4), which apart from its major role as a key factor of the innate immune system, is believed to play a role … Show more

“…The likely candidate for transmitting paclitaxel signalling is Toll-like receptor-4 (TLR4) [34]. Tichomirowa et al [35] evaluated 21 meningiomas (19 of them benign) which expressed TLR4 mRNA and protein at variable degree. TAX exhibited dose-and time-dependent growth suppression in the meningioma cell cultures [35].…”

“…Results thus far are derived from in vitro studies only, and show favorable results. 15,33 Tichomirowa et al 73 recently published an in vitro study in which an entirely novel strategy of inducing apoptosis in meningioma cells via inhibition of Toll-like receptor 4 with paclitaxel was used. The meningioma cell cultures used in this experiment exhibited dose-and time-dependent growth suppression following paclitaxel treatment, which was further amplified following addition of a statin medication.…”
